The Lagos State Command Public Relations Officer of the Nigerian Police, Benjamin Hundeyin has condemned citizens attitudes toward the officers of Nigeria Police Force, mostly, when they are involved in a dastard occurrence.

Hundeyin revealed this while reacting to the ways some citizens reacted to a report that some officers of Nigeria Police Force got involved in an accident, along the Third Mainland Bridge in Lagos. He regretted that a few number of people have identified with the reportage, over the time, claiming that had the news been against the police, it would have trended.

He said "35 mins and just 7 retweets. Flip this, let it be a police van involved in hit and run and watch the retweets increase exponentially.

Hundeyin claimed that residents usually ignore the good deeds of the police and give priority to false impressions against the Force. He said "same way the many daily good deeds of the police are shunned, giving the false impression it’s all about negativity and mediocrity.

Hundeyin was reacting to a news that a van belonging to the Police was involved in a hit and run motor collision with a civilian on the Third Mainland bridge.

The Lagos State Transportation Management Agency (LASTMA) had early reported that some police officers were involved in a road accident, which was caused by a hit and run driver.
